How much do part time physical therapy j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 17, 2026, the average hourly pay for part time physical therapy in Reno, NV is $31.85,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$26.83 and $35.48 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is part time physical therapy?

Part time physical therapy refers to rehabilitation or treatment services provided by a licensed physical therapist on a part-time basis, either as a job arrangement or for patients who do not require full-time care. Physical therapists help patients recover from injuries, surgeries, or manage chronic conditions by developing personalized movement and exercise plans. Part time physical therapists may work in clinics, hospitals, nursing homes, or provide home health services, and often have flexible schedules. This arrangement can benefit both therapists seeking work-life balance and patients needing less frequent sessions.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part-time physical therapist?

To excel as a Part-Time Physical Therapist, you need a degree in physical therapy, a state license, and a solid grasp of anatomy, rehabilitation techniques, and patient assessment. Familiarity with electronic health records (EHRs), therapeutic modalities, and exercise equipment is standard, while certifications like CPR may be required. Strong interpersonal skills, empathy, and adaptability help you connect with patients and manage varied caseloads efficiently. These competencies ensure effective patient recovery, compliance with regulations, and high-quality care even within limited hours.

How does working part time in physical therapy impact opportunities for professional development and advancement?

Working part time in physical therapy can still offer meaningful opportunities for professional growth, including access to continuing education, mentorship, and specialized training. However, part-time therapists may need to be proactive in seeking out these opportunities, as some employers prioritize full-time staff for internal development programs. Building strong relationships with colleagues and supervisors and expressing interest in career advancement can help open doors to leadership roles or specialty certifications. Many clinics also support flexible scheduling for workshops or courses, enabling part-time therapists to continue growing their skills while balancing other commitments.

What is the difference between Part Time Physical Therapy vs Physical Therapist Assistant?

AspectPart Time Physical TherapyPhysical Therapist Assistant
CredentialsLicensed Physical Therapist (Doctor of Physical Therapy or DPT)Associate's Degree in Physical Therapy Assisting, State License
Work EnvironmentHospitals, clinics, outpatient centers, schoolsRehabilitation centers, outpatient clinics, nursing homes
Job RoleDevelops treatment plans, evaluates patients, oversees therapyAssists Physical Therapists, implements treatment plans, monitors patient progress

Part Time Physical Therapy involves licensed therapists providing direct patient care, while Physical Therapist Assistants support therapists by executing treatment plans under supervision. Both roles are essential in rehabilitation settings, but they differ in credentials and responsibilities.

Universal Health Services (UHS) is a major player in the healthcare industry, based in King of Prussia, Pennsylvania, U.S. Founded in 1978, UHS offers hospital and healthcare services. Their diverse services range from acute care hospitals, behavioral health facilities and ambulatory centers nationwide. The company's mission of enhancing the health and well-being of their patients is reflected in their commitment to 'Helping Individuals Live Longer, Healthier and Happier Lives'. Universal Health Services' consistent growth and success in their industry have been recognized on numerous occasions, including being ranked amongst the Fortune 500 list of largest companies.
